A massive earthquake occurs along the New Madrid fault line that leads to tremendous damage and loss of life all along the Eastern Seaboard of the United States. The military is dispatched to help the nation respond to the incident.

Shortly thereafter, a situation arises in another part of the world necessitating a military response. Opponents of mobilizing the military for disaster response and recovery argue that using the military for these types of incidents compromises the ability of the military to respond to other high-level incidents.

The Posse Comitatus Act of 1878 outlines provisions for limiting federal military personnel to enforce the laws of the land. To what extent are disaster response and recovery activities restricted to civilian efforts? When should the military become involved in disaster response and recovery?
